Cross-border asset tracing for construction group with links to offshore fund diversion

Our team conducted a comprehensive asset-tracing investigation of a corporate group in the construction sector. As part of asset tracing exercise, the operational framework of interconnected companies was mapped, enabling the reconstruction of their business perimeter and the identification of key profit accumulation centers and cash generating units. The investigation uncovered held assets – including production facilities and quarries – across jurisdictions in the Middle East, Europe, and Africa.

Further scrutiny was applied to the asset holdings of senior executives within the corporate group, who held decision-making authority. The analysis revealed a material link between a network of individuals and a prominent IT corporation implicated in facilitating fund diversion schemes through offshore vehicles. Additionally, personal assets – such as hospitality holdings and residential properties – were traced to high-value real estate markets in Southeast Asia and the Middle East. The investigation also identified the individuals' cryptocurrency holdings and analyzed the transaction chains that led to their accumulation.
